Preconditioning with hydrogen sulfide ameliorates cerebral ischemia/reperfusion injury in a mouse model of transient middle cerebral artery occlusion.

Abstract

Ischemic stroke and reperfusion injury are a common and serve medical situation in the elderly population. HS is a gas neuromodulator which also possesses anti-oxidant and anti-inflammatory properties, and is found to play neuroprotective effect in neurodegenerative diseases. This study investigated the effect of endogenous and exogenous HS in a mouse model of ischemic stroke. 129P2-Cbs/J mice with heterozygous mutants in HS generating enzyme cystathionine β-synthase were used to study the effect of endogenous HS. HS donor NaHS was used as exogenous HS. Animals were pretreated with HS and then subjected to middle cerebral artery occlusion surgery. Behavioral outcome was evaluated by novel object recognition test. Inflammatory cytokines were measured using ELISA. Western blot was used to detect the activation of NF-κB. Aged 129P2-Cbs/J mice showed exaggerated inflammation and more severe cognitive impairment after ischemia, while exogenous HS treatment inhibited inflammation and attenuated behavioral impairment. The anti-inflammatory effect of HS was mediated by inhibiting NF-κB. Our findings suggest that both endogenous and exogenous HS are involved in the neuroprotection against ischemia/reperfusion-induced cerebral injury.
